Peculiarities Of Physical Readiness Of Young Men And Women Engaged In Freestyle Wrestling

Authors: Tropin, Y.;

Peculiarities Of Physical Readiness Of Young Men And Women Engaged In Freestyle Wrestling

Abstract

Purpose: to determine the features of physical fitness of young men and women in free-style wrestling. Material and Methods: analysis of scientific and methodological information, generalization of best practical experience, pedagogical testing, methods of mathematical statistics. Twenty-four young athletes (12 young men and 12 girls) participated in the studies, which are engaged in free-style wrestling in the preliminary training groups of the first year of study, the age of the subjects 12-13 years, the experience of 3-4 years. Results: revealed that the main aspects of the method of physical training with young wrestlers is the targeted development of physical qualities, taking into account the age periods and sensitive phases of the development of a particular motor quality and the use of the most informative tests in pedagogical control. As a result of the study, it was determined that the results of physical fitness for young men are significantly higher in such tests: 10 meters run (t=-3,80; p<0,001); a long jump from the place (t=2,98; p<0,01); shuttle race 4×9 meters (t=-3,89; p<0,001); 10 runs on the bridge (t=-3,04; p<0,01); 10 reversals on the «bridge» (t=-3,75; p<0,01); squatting for 20 s (t=3,88; p<0,001). In the gymnastic «bridge» test, the indices are significantly better in girls (t=4,86; p<0,001), which is explained by the specificity of the female body. Conclusions: it was found that the practice of free-style wrestling positively influenced the development of physical qualities and emotional state of young athletes. As a result of the study, it was determined that young people, almost all, had better test results (running 10 meters at 13 %, long jump at 7 %, shuttle running 4x9 meters at 11 %, 10 running on the «bridge» at 10 %, 10 coups on the «bridge» by 9 %, squats in 20 seconds by 14 %), and girls have better indicators in the gymnastic «bridge» test by 37 %.

Keywords

free-style wrestling; physical fitness; physical qualities; young athletes
